How Our Sewage Water Extraction Process Works

So, how exactly do we tackle this tricky situation? It all starts with a rapid assessment of the damage where our team identifies the source and extent of the problem. From there, we get to work with our high-capacity pumps and vacuum trucks carefully extracting the sewage water and removing any hazardous materials. The whole process is completed within 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team arrives on the scene, assesses the damage, and sets up containment barriers to prevent further contamination. This step is crucial in preventing the spread of sewage water and reducing the risk of health hazards.

Step 2: Extraction and Removal

We use our powerful pumps and vacuum trucks to extract the sewage water, removing up to 2 inches of standing water in a single pass. Our team works tirelessly to remove all sources of contamination and restore your home to a safe and healthy environment.

Step 3: Disinfection and Decontamination

Once the extraction is complete, we move on to disinfecting and decontaminating your property using specialized equipment and environmentally friendly chemicals to remove any remaining bacteria or pathogens.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Restoration

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ure your home is safe and healthy, and provides you with a detailed report of the work completed. We also offer restoration services to help you get your home back to its original state.

Warning Signs You Need Sewage Water Extraction

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Don’t risk it, act quickly to pr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ors that persist even after cleaning and disinfecting may show the presence of sewage water. Don’t ignore these odors they can be a sign of a more serious problem.

Water Stains and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can show sewage water infiltration.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to costly repairs and health hazards.

Backed-Up Toilets and Drains

Repeated backups or slow-draining toilets and sinks can be a sign of a more serious issue, sewage water overflow. Call a pro to prevent further damage and health hazards.

Unusual Noises and Vibrations

Strange noises or vibrations coming from your pipes or walls can show sewage water accumulation. Don’t ignore these signs they can be a sign of a more serious problem.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Water damage, warping, or buckling of flooring, walls, or ceilings can show sewage water infiltration. Act quickly to prevent further damage and health hazards.

Sewage Water Extraction Cost in Hooper, UT

The cost of sewage water extraction in Hooper, UT, var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ates and works with you to create a customized plan that fits your budget and needs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and complexity of containment
Extraction and Removal $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of sewage water, equipment needed, and labor hours
Disinfection and Decontamination $500 – $2,000 Type of chemicals used, amount of surface area, and labor hours
Restoration Services $2,000 – $10,000 Scope of work, materials needed, and labor hours
